Establishment of Class E Airspace; Buckhannon, WV

AGENCY: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) DOT.

ACTION: Final rule.

-----------------------------------------------------------------------

SUMMARY: This action establishes Class E airspace at Buckhannon, WV. 
Controlled airspace extending upward from 700 feet Above Ground Level 
(AGL) is needed to contain aircraft operating into Upshur County 
Regional Airport, Buckhannon, WV under Instrument Flight Rules (IFR).

The Rule

    This amendment to part 71 of the Federal Aviation Regulations (14 
CFR part 71) provides controlled Class E airspace extending upward from 
700 feet above the surface for aircraft conducting IFR operations 
within a 6-mile radius of Upshur County Regional Airport, Buckhannon, 
WV.
    The FAA has determined that this regulation only involves an 
established body of technical regulations for which frequent and 
routine amendments are necessary to keep them operationally current. 
Therefore, this regulation (1) Is not a ``significant regulatory 
action'' under Executive Order 12866; (2) is not a ``significant rule'' 
under DOT Regulatory Policies and Procedures (44 FR 11034; February 26, 
1979); and (3) does not warrant preparation of a Regulatory Evaluation 
as the anticipated impact is so minimal. Since this is a routine matter 
that will only affected air traffic procedures and air navigation, it 
is certified that this rule will not have significant economic impact 
on a substantial number of small entities under the criteria of the 
Regulatory Flexibility Act.

Paragraph 6005 Class E Airspace Areas extending upward from 700 
feet or more above the surface of the earth.

* * * * *

AEA WV E5, Buckhannon, WV [NEW]

Upshur County Regional Airport, WV
    (Lat. 39[deg]00'01'' N., long. 80[deg]16'26'' W.)

    That airspace extending upward from 700 feet above the surface 
within a 6-mile radius of Upshur County Airport, excluding that 
portion that coincides with the Clarksburg, WV Class E airspace 
area.
